What difference does it make if Boooyahooo is your best friend or the thought of him makes you puke? His opinions are only that, an opinion. And everyone has one. If you don't have it in you to do your own due diligence or home work before you take a position in any stock, then you really don't have any business trading stocks or investing in the markets anyway.

A tip or opinion you receive from anyone, whether it be on a forum like this, an article you read, or something you hear on a news show, should always be researched with your own work. If you rush off to buy or sell based on something someone says, you are surely destined for failure.

You've all heard the saying, "buyer beware" ! It chaps my a** when I hear someone griping about a loss they took on a stock because of something someone else said or did. If you lose because of it, it's no one's fault but your own.

If you want my honest opinion of Boooyahooo, I think he's a freakin' nutcase, but he's got as much right to his say so here as anyone else, regardless if it goes contrary to popular opinion! I don't give a hoot what he thinks about a stock, I'll make up my mind based on my own research.
